Average 3K-4K entries. I've fished it in the 90's when there were 6500+ entries. before daylight Farmers and Needmore looked like small cities with all the nav lights. I haven't fished it in 5 years and may never fish it again.

My only time to fish it (2004 for the 20 year anniversary I think). We were pulling up on our waypoint off of Needmore at 4:30 AM, asked my partner if we were in the wrong place because there shouldn't be that many houses/lights where we were going. Turns out we were probably the 3rd or 4th ROW of boats around the point. Crazy amount of people.
